The Fascinating History Of The Hawthorne Hotel

Early Days Of The Hotel

The Hawthorne Hotel, located in Salem, Massachusetts, has a rich history that dates back to the early 20th century. The hotel was built in 1925 by a group of local businessmen who wanted to create a grand hotel in the heart of the city. The Hawthorne Hotel was named after Nathaniel Hawthorne, a famous author who was born in Salem in 1804.

During its early days, the Hawthorne Hotel quickly became a popular destination for travelers and locals alike. The hotel’s luxurious accommodations and prime location made it a hub for social events and business meetings.

One of the most notable events in the early history of the Hawthorne Hotel was the Salem Witch Trials Tercentenary Celebration in 1930. The celebration marked the 300th anniversary of the infamous witch trials that took place in Salem in 1692. The Hawthorne Hotel played a significant role in the event, hosting many of the celebrations and providing accommodations for guests.

Throughout the years, the Hawthorne Hotel has undergone several renovations and upgrades to keep up with modern standards while still maintaining its historic charm. Today, the hotel is known as one of the premier destinations in Salem, offering guests a unique blend of history and luxury.

Renovation And Modernization

The Hawthorne Hotel has undergone several renovations and modernizations throughout its history to keep up with the changing times and needs of its guests. One of the most significant renovations occurred in the 1980s when the hotel underwent a complete overhaul to restore it to its former glory.

During this renovation, the hotel’s interior was updated with modern amenities while still maintaining its historic charm. The guest rooms were redesigned to include private bathrooms, air conditioning, and cable television, among other features.

The hotel’s public spaces were also updated during this time, including the lobby, restaurant, and meeting rooms. The grand ballroom was restored to its original splendor, featuring crystal chandeliers, ornate plasterwork, and a spacious dance floor.

In 2019, the hotel underwent another renovation to update its guest rooms and public spaces once again. This renovation focused on enhancing the hotel’s sustainability efforts by incorporating energy-efficient lighting, low-flow plumbing fixtures, and eco-friendly materials.

As part of this renovation, the hotel’s guest rooms were updated with new furniture, bedding, and décor to create a more modern and comfortable experience for guests. The lobby was also refreshed with new seating areas, artwork, and lighting fixtures.

The Hawthorne Hotel continues to evolve and adapt to meet the needs of its guests while preserving its rich history and architectural beauty. Its commitment to sustainability and modernization ensures that it will remain a top destination for travelers for years to come.

The House Of The Seven Gables

The House of the Seven Gables is one of the most popular historical sites in Salem, Massachusetts. This iconic mansion was built in 1668 and has been preserved to showcase the rich history of the town. The house is known for its unique architecture, featuring seven gables on the roof that give it its name.

The House of the Seven Gables was made famous by Nathaniel Hawthorne’s novel of the same name, which was published in 1851. The novel tells the story of a cursed family who lived in the house and the secrets that they kept hidden within its walls. Today, visitors can tour the house and see the rooms where Hawthorne set his story.

In addition to the main house, there are several other buildings on the property that offer insight into life in Salem during the 17th and 18th centuries. These include the Retire Beckett House, which was moved to the site in 1924 and now serves as a museum dedicated to Salem’s maritime history.

Salem Maritime National Historic Site

Salem Maritime National Historic Site is a popular destination in Salem, Massachusetts. It is a historic site that preserves one of the most important ports in the United States during the 18th and 19th centuries. The site features several historic buildings, including the Custom House and the Derby Wharf.

The Custom House was built in 1819 and served as the center of Salem’s maritime trade. It was also the workplace of Nathaniel Hawthorne, the famous American author who wrote The Scarlet Letter. Today, visitors can take a tour of the Custom House and learn about its history.

The Derby Wharf is another highlight of the Salem Maritime National Historic Site. It was built in the late 18th century and was once the longest wharf in the world. Visitors can walk along the wharf and enjoy views of Salem Harbor. There are also several historic buildings on the wharf, including the Derby Wharf Light Station.

One of the most interesting aspects of the Salem Maritime National Historic Site is its collection of ships. The site has several historic vessels, including the Friendship of Salem, a replica of a 1797 East Indiaman. Visitors can board the ship and explore its decks.
